Situated in Orange County, this park attracts visitors all year-round for numerous reasons.
Firstly, Saddleback View Park provides ample opportunities for outdoor activities and recreation. Hiking enthusiasts can explore the park's extensive trail system, which winds through diverse landscapes, including rolling hills, picturesque canyons, and breathtaking coastal views. The park's well-maintained trails cater to all skill levels, making it accessible for both beginners and experienced hikers.
Additionally, Saddleback View Park is home to a diverse range of flora and fauna, making it an excellent spot for nature lovers and wildlife enthusiasts. The park boasts several lookout points that offer panoramic views of the surrounding area, including the Santa Ana Mountains and the shimmering Pacific Ocean.
While exploring the park, visitors may come across interesting features such as the iconic Santiago Peak, the highest point in Orange County, which provides a challenging yet rewarding hike for experienced adventurers. The park's rolling hills are also often adorned with vibrant wildflowers, creating a stunning sight during the blooming season.
Moreover, Saddleback View Park has a rich history and cultural significance. The park lies within the traditional lands of the Acjachemen and Tongva Native American tribes, adding a layer of cultural importance to the area. Visitors can learn about the region's indigenous history and heritage through interpretive signs and educational programs offered within the park.
The best time to visit Saddleback View Park is during spring and fall, as the weather is pleasant, and the flora is in full bloom. However, California's mild climate allows for year-round visitation, making it a suitable destination for outdoor enthusiasts at any time.
